FAQIs there such a thing as over-use of analgesics to treat headaches? Overuse of anything is not a good thing and this includes the overuse of analgesics or caffeine to treat tension-type and migraine headaches which tend to make them worse. How long does a migraine attack last? Migraine attacks may last from 4 to 72 hours and may occur frequently for a long period of time but may disappear for many weeks, months or even years. Is having a Migraine connected in any way to genetics? A rare subtype of migraine called Familial Hemiplegic Migraine is associated with a genetic defect on chromosomes 1 and 19 but the roles of genes in the more common forms of migraine are still under study.
